ABSTRACT

Objective: The aim of this study was to compare the hemodynamic effects of manual spinal manipulation (MSM) and instrumental spinal manipulation (ISM) on the vertebral artery (VA) and internal carotid artery (ICA) in participants with chronic nonspecific neck pain (NNP). Methods: Thirty volunteers aged 20 to 40 years old with NNP over 3 months duration were included. Participants were randomly divided into the following 2 groups: (1) MSM group (n = 15) and (2) ISM group (n = 15). Ipsilateral (intervention side) and contralateral (opposite side of intervention) VAs and ICAs were evaluated using spectral color Doppler ultrasound before and immediately after manipulation. Measurements were recorded by visualizing the ICA carotid sinus (C4 level) and the VA at the V3 segment (C1-C2 level). The blood flow parameters of peak systolic velocity (PSV), end-diastolic velocity, resistive index, and volume flow (only for VA) were evaluated. The spinal segment, in which biomechanical aberrant movement was detected by palpation in the upper cervical spine, was manually manipulated in the MSM group. The same methodology was performed for the ISM group using an Activator V instrument (Activator Methods). Results: Intragroup analysis exhibited no statistically significant difference between the MSM and ISM groups in terms of PSV, end-diastolic velocity, resistive index of ipsilateral and contralateral ICA and VA, in addition to volume flow of both VAs preintervention and postintervention (P > .05). Within the intergroup analysis, there was a significant difference in ipsilateral ICA PSV (P = .031) (preintervention vs postintervention difference was -7.9 ± 17.2 cm/s [95% confidence interval, -17.4 to 1.6] in the ISM group and 8.7 ± 22.5 cm/s [95% confidence interval, -3.6 to 21.2]) in the MSM group (P < .05). Other parameters did not show any significant difference (P > .05). Conclusion: Manual and instrumental spinal manipulations applied to the upper cervical spine in participants with chronic NNP did not appear to alter blood flow parameters of the VAs and ICAs.

ABSTRACT

OBJECTIVE: The coronavirus disease-2019 (COVID-19) pandemic has strained all levels of healthcare and it is not known how chiropractic practitioners have responded to this crisis. The purpose of this report is to describe responses by a sample of chiropractors during the early stages of the COVID-19 pandemic. METHODS: We used a qualitative-constructivist design to understand chiropractic practice during the COVID-19 pandemic, as described by the participants. A sample of chiropractic practitioners (doctors of chiropractic, chiropractors) from various international locations were invited to participate. Each described the public health response to COVID-19 in their location and the actions that they took in their chiropractic practices from April 20 through May 4, 2020. A summary report was created from their responses and common themes were identified. RESULTS: Eighteen chiropractic practitioners representing 17 locations and 11 countries participated. A variety of practice environments were represented in this sample, including, solo practice, mobile practice, private hospital, US Veterans Administration health care, worksite health center, and group practice. They reported that they recognized and abided by changing governmental regulations. They observed their patients experience increased stress and mental health concerns resulting from the pandemic. They adopted innovative strategies, such as telehealth, to do outreach, communicate with, and provide care for patients. They abided by national and World Health Organization recommendations and they adopted creative strategies to maintain connectivity with patients through a people-centered, integrated, and collaborative approach. CONCLUSION: Although the chiropractors in this sample practiced in different cities and countries, their compliance with local regulations, concern for staff and patient safety, and people-centered responses were consistent. This sample covers all 7 World Federation of Chiropractic regions (ie, African, Asian, Eastern Mediterranean, European, Latin American, North American, and Pacific) and provides insights into measures taken by chiropractors during the early stages of the COVID-19 pandemic. This information may assist the chiropractic profession as it prepares for different scenarios as new evidence about this disease evolves.
